About Bristol Elementary School

Bristol Elementary School is a public elementary school in Bristol, VT, part of Mt. Abraham Unified School District #61. Bristol Elementary School serves approximately 394 students, and covers grades Pre-K-6th, and has a 17.9:1 student-teacher ratio.

Bristol Elementary School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 7.3 out of 10 and ranks #92 of 280 schools in VT. Structured state assessment records for Bristol Elementary School show 37%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2020-2022) and 52%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2020-2022).

What Parents Should Know

Bristol Elementary School sits in a rural area, which can mean longer drives for some families. Rural schools are often community anchors with smaller classes, but check transportation, after-school options, and access to specialized services before you commit.
